Still in shipping box as I never got a chance to install it in my truck. Never even opened the box. Originally made for 2018+ Freightliner Cascadia Trucks (P4) with the cabinet delete option. For installation in the 2018+ (CA126) P4 Cascadia trucks, the fridge fits perfectly on the mounting pad and is held in place with the straps provided with the cabinet delete option. Note: You might need an (optional) P4 Wiring Kit (CPLUG) and is available as an Accessory at a cost of around $25 and may be necessary for installation in a Cascadia truck. This fridge may also fit in most closets on the 63" Pete without the door. Of course you can use this in anything else for custom installation and not just semi-trucks. Note: For custom installations, please consider adding an (optional) mounting flange to ensure that you can properly secure the fridge into your custom cabinet. Here are the details... *Model: TF86FS *Volume (CU ft/Liters): 3.0/86 *Dimensions HxWxD (inches): 34x15x21 *Power consumption (W/24h): 520 (6 amp draw on a 15amp circuit) Average 40 amps /24hrs). *Weight: 62 lbs *Built-in, silent, highly efficient, fan cooled 12vDC SECOP BD1.4F VSD Micro compressor. *No power inverter necessary! Connects to the 12v factory fridge wiring. ***Connection to a cigarette lighter plug is NOT recommended. *Built-in low voltage cut-out and overvoltage protection. *Insulation is high density, CFC-free polyurethane foam. *Replaceable black door panel and reversible door hinge location. *Door latch provides positive closure. *Fridge liner is made from thermoformed plastic for easy clean up. *Interior LED light. *Adjustable electromechanical temperature control. *Forced air cooled static wire condenser for optimal performance.
